Написать программу на языке си++ в течени 24-ёх часов

Гость3 года в сервисе
Данные заказчика будут вам доступны после подачи заявки
12.09.2022

Используя стек, решить следующую задачу.

В текстовом файле LOG записано без ошибок логическое

выражение (ЛВ) в следующей форме: <::= True="" |="" False="" |="" (="" !="" <ЛВ=""> ) | (

Например: ( ! (T + F) * (F + T))). Вычислить (как boolean) значение

этого выражения. Знаки !, *, + означают соответственно отрицание,

конъюнкцию и дизъюнкцию.

Для реализации АТД Стек использовать динамическое

распределение памяти.

Вместо T и F можно использовать численные значения , но формула должна быть та же

Операнды заносить в один стек , а операторы в другой